What is the population of Alexander?
Alexander has a population of 3,854 residents and is located in Manitoba. The population density is 7 people per square mile, spread across 602.3 square miles. The median age of residents is 58.4 years, which is older than the national median of 38.9 years. The population is 48.1% female and 51.9% male.

What is the weather like in Alexander?
Alexander has a cool climate with an average annual temperature of 36°F (2°C). Winter temperatures average -0°F in January, while summers reach an average of 66°F in July. The area receives 299 sunny days per year, well above the national average of 205. Annual rainfall totals 20.4 inches, with 4.2 inches of snow.
